H.CON.RES.340: Expressing the sense of the Congress with respect to the effective treatment of and access to care for individuals with psoriasis and psoriatic arthritis, and for other purposes.

Bill Summary
Urges: (1) the Director of the National Institutes of Health (NIH) and the Director of the National Institute of Arthritis and Musculoskeletal and Skin Diseases to continue to take a leadership role in identifying a cure and developing safer, more effective treatments for psoriasis and psoriatic arthritis; and (2) the Secretary of Health and Human Services to convene, by August 2006 (Psoriasis Awareness Month), a special panel to study and...
(Source: Library of Congress)
